The Mind's Mutiny: Mental Illness and the Law
This program examines the intersection of mental illness and the practice of law. Inspired by the Herman Wouk’s Pulitzer Prize-winning novel, “The Caine Mutiny”, members were engaged in discussion to determine whether the actions of officers to relieve a mentally unstable commander were justifiable. Presenters also provided members with best practices on how to handle matters that involve members of the public and profession with a mental illness.
